Ray175INF Posted March 2, 2018 Author Share #10 Posted March 2, 2018 Thank you for the kind comments, it didn't come with a liner, theres faded initials inside the pot VLD or VLB The net feels pretty stiff, I think it's been on it for some time now and it'll stay on it. The Vet used brass wire to secure the chinstraps, something I haven't seen before, it would be cool to see if there are any other examples that have had that done.
